Finding Table Scans

Use SQL Server diagnostic queries to identify table scans that may point to missing indexes or inefficient query patterns.

Example and Notes

Table scans are not always bad, but unexpected scans on large or frequently used tables can signal performance opportunities.

Create Procedure uspGetTableScans
AS
 
WITH XMLNAMESPACES(DEFAULT N'http://schemas.microsoft.com/sqlserver/2004/07/showplan'),
CachedPlans
(
ParentOperationID,
OperationID,
PhysicalOperator,
LogicalOperator,
EstimatedCost,
EstimatedIO,
EstimatedCPU,
EstimatedRows,
PlanHandle,
QueryText,
QueryPlan,
CacheObjectType,
ObjectType)
AS
(
SELECT
RelOp.op.value(N'../../@NodeId', N'int') AS ParentOperationID,
RelOp.op.value(N'@NodeId', N'int') AS OperationID,
RelOp.op.value(N'@PhysicalOp', N'varchar(50)') AS PhysicalOperator,
RelOp.op.value(N'@LogicalOp', N'varchar(50)') AS LogicalOperator,
RelOp.op.value(N'@EstimatedTotalSubtreeCost ', N'float') AS EstimatedCost,
RelOp.op.value(N'@EstimateIO', N'float') AS EstimatedIO,
RelOp.op.value(N'@EstimateCPU', N'float') AS EstimatedCPU,
RelOp.op.value(N'@EstimateRows', N'float') AS EstimatedRows,
cp.plan_handle AS PlanHandle,
st.TEXT AS QueryText,
qp.query_plan AS QueryPlan,
cp.cacheobjtype AS CacheObjectType,
cp.objtype AS ObjectType
FROM sys.dm_exec_cached_plans cp
CROSS APPLY sys.dm_exec_sql_text(cp.plan_handle) st
CROSS APPLY sys.dm_exec_query_plan(cp.plan_handle) qp
CROSS APPLY qp.query_plan.nodes(N'//RelOp') RelOp (op)
)
SELECT
PlanHandle,
ParentOperationID,
OperationID,
PhysicalOperator,
LogicalOperator,
QueryText,
CacheObjectType,
ObjectType,
EstimatedCost,
EstimatedIO,
EstimatedCPU,
EstimatedRows
FROM CachedPlans
WHERE CacheObjectType = N'Compiled Plan'
       And PhysicalOperator = 'Table Scan'
